The defense of the president of Atlas Group, Dr. Duško Knežević, filed a criminal complaint against Vlatko Rašović, Đorđe Đurđić and several other perpetrators - members of the police, to the Special State Prosecutor's Office in Podgorica, Atlas Group announced.
Atlas Group announced that "the criminal report charges the suspects Đurđić and Rašović with the criminal offense of Giving a false statement from Article 389, paragraph 4, in connection with paragraph 1 of the Criminal Code of Montenegro, and for the time being, the NN members of the police are charged with the criminal offense of Abuse official position from Article 416, paragraph 3, in connection with paragraph 1 of the Criminal Code of Montenegro."
"During 2019, on several occasions in Podgorica, before the SDT of Montenegro, they gave false statements as witnesses, which led to the initiation of criminal proceedings and the indictment against Duško Knežević, as a result of which there were serious consequences for the injured party, as and in relation to his property," announced lawyer Zdravko Đukanović.
The Atlas Group adds that "the members of the National Police, whose identity will be determined during the criminal proceedings, by exploiting their official position and exceeding the limits of their authority, illegally pressured Đurđić and Rašović to give false statements in the criminal proceedings against Duško Knežević These actions were carried out by order of the executive power, in order to help SDT and Podgorica to initiate illegal proceedings against Duško Knežević.
"The mentioned persons are under pressure, and due to the lack of any material evidence against Duško Knežević, they made several untrue and arbitrary claims, so that the proceedings would still be conducted, and in order to create a wrong image in the public about the events in which Vlatko Rašović and Đorđe Đurđić participated. The defense will propose that Special State Prosecutor Milivoje Katnić, President of Montenegro Milo Đukanović and Branimir Gvozdenović be heard as witnesses. Duško Knežević's defense will submit an amendment to this criminal report after receiving the remaining relevant information," Đukanović said.
